Hey all, I don't know if any of you are also in contact with the Austin DSA, but they sent this email yesterday and I think it's relevant to us:
#Austin #survillance #ATX #datacenters #dsa

Item 24 [1] on this Thursday's [City Council] agenda directs the City Manager to basically rewrite the City's economic incentive policy, calling out a number of specific industries that the Mayor wants to target - including the AI industry. Unfortunately, this means that Data Centers, AI surveillance companies, and other harmful businesses could beef up their profits by paying even less into collective systems that support us all than they already do. For a lot more information on this, particularly the defense contractor angle, see this resource doc [2] put together by Austin for Palestine Coalition.

During the call today, we decided that we want to mobilize against this item, ideally to block it entirely given there is skepticism that these kinds of economic incentive policies actually raise enough tax revenue to offset the freebies given to lure businesses here. But even if they did pay off, we would want to oppose our tax dollars going to businesses that we know are profiting off of harm, and so we do not want a blanket goal of targeting AI companies.

We support a blanket ban on Data Centers, companies linked to defense tech, AI surveillance companies, or companies that have paid zero in federal income tax in any of the last 7 years. If you support that stance, please reach out to your City Council member via email & call (see info here [3]), and in-person or remote testimony on Thursday (registration link here [4]).
